Hakata Gion Yamakasa Festival: A Celebration of Tradition
Now, let’s take a closer look at the Hakata Gion Yamakasa Festival, which has been captivating locals and tourists alike for centuries. This vibrant festival, held every July, is a celebration of the town’s rich history and cultural heritage. It originated over 700 years ago as a way to purify the city during the hot summer months and has since evolved into a grand spectacle that draws thousands of visitors each year.
Yamakasa Festival History
The roots of the Yamakasa Festival can be traced back to the Edo period, when it began as a purification ritual. Over time, it transformed into a competitive event featuring elaborately decorated floats known as “yamakasa.” These floats, which can weigh up to a ton, are paraded through the streets of Hakata by teams of spirited participants, showcasing their strength and teamwork. The festival’s historical significance is not just in its origins; it has become a symbol of community spirit and pride, with each neighborhood vying to put on the best display.
Yamakasa Traditions
The festival is steeped in traditions that reflect the values of the Hakata community. One of the most fascinating aspects is the ritual of the “Kazariyama,” where beautifully crafted floats are displayed for public admiration. These floats are adorned with intricate designs and represent various themes, often reflecting local lore or historical events. Each float tells a story, inviting visitors to delve deeper into the cultural tapestry of Fukuoka.
Another exciting tradition is the early morning practice runs leading up to the main race day. Locals wake up before dawn to participate in these spirited rehearsals, which are open for visitors to watch. It’s a fantastic opportunity to witness the dedication and enthusiasm of the participants, as well as to feel the palpable excitement building in the air as the festival approaches.
As you prepare for your visit, keep in mind that the Yamakasa Festival history is rich with lesser-known facts and stories. Did you know that the festival was designated an Important Intangible Folk Cultural Asset by the Japanese government? This recognition highlights its cultural significance and the need to preserve its traditions for future generations.

Feel Revived by Cultural Activities & Hot Springs on a Trip to Ehime
Ehime Prefecture offers an abundance of nature and culture. It is full of exciting sea and mountain activities, such as cycling the 70 km Shimanami Kaido route around the islands in the Seto Inland Sea, trekking the Shikoku Pilgrimage, and climbing Mt. Ishizuchi—the highest peak of western Japan. You can also relax at Dogo Onsen, one of Japan’s most famous hot spring areas, or explore Ehime’s historical spots, like Matsuyama Castle and the Edo Period towns. It takes around 30 minutes to travel from Matsuyama Airport to Matsuyama City by airport bus. And with trams that travel within Matsuyama City and to Dogo Onsen, accessing tourist attractions around the area couldn’t be easier!
